我目前正在尝试将一组包含数据的JSON文件导入我在IBMBluemix/Compose上托管的mongo数据库。我有一个脚本,它通过创建文件然后运行mongoimport命令将文件导入数据库,这对我的本地数据库(实际上偶尔对Compose数据库)非常有效,但是大多数时候我得到以下错误-2017-05-09T14:59:02.508+0100Failed:errorconnectingtodbserver:SSLerrors:x509certificateroutines:X509_STORE_add_cert:certalreadyinhashtablex509certificat
我正在尝试执行MongoAPI以在AzureCosmos-DB上执行CRUD操作。我正在Azure数据资源管理器上运行查询。这是我正在执行的查询{db.getCollectionNames()}我正面临{"code":500,"body":"{\"message\":\"处理您的请求时出错。请稍后重试。\",\"httpStatusCode\":\"InternalServerError\",\"xMsServerRequestId\":null,\"stackTrace\":null}"}如果我在这里做错了,您能否提出更改建议。 最佳答案
我正在尝试将数据从POSTMAN发布到我在mLab上创建的外部数据库,但我收到错误db.collectionisnotafunction。有一个类似的问题线程,但答案不完整,并且没有将我放入postman的任何键/值保存到mLab。我尝试使用的代码来自本教程:https://medium.freecodecamp.com/building-a-simple-node-js-api-in-under-30-minutes-a07ea9e390d2我的代码:服务器.jsconstexpress=require('express');//LoadroutesapplicationconstM
一、介绍:INSERTOVERWRITETABLE是用于覆盖(即替换)目标表中的数据的操作。它将新的数据写入表中,并删除原有的数据。这个操作适用于非分区表和分区表。二、使用场景:1、数据更新:当您需要更新表中的数据时,可以使用覆写操作。通过覆写,您可以将新的数据写入表中,替换原有的数据。这在需要定期更新或替换表中数据的情况下非常有用。2、数据重载:如果您需要重新加载表中的数据,覆写操作可以清空表并将新的数据加载进去。这在数据仓库或数据分析任务中很常见,当需要重新加载或替换表中的数据时,覆写操作是一个快速有效的方法。3、数据清理:当需要删除表中的数据时,可以使用覆写操作。通过将一个空表覆写到目标
我有很多字段的用户模型,我想显示一个表作为其中2个字段的矩阵:-创建时间-类型对于created_at,我只是这样使用了一个group_by:(User.where(:type=>"blabla").all.group_by{|item|item.send(:created_at).strftime("%Y-%m-%d")}).sort.eachdo|creation_date,users|这给了我每个创建日期的所有用户的一个很好的数组,所以我table上的线条没问题。但是我想显示多行,每个代表每种类型的用户的子选择。所以目前,我每行执行一个请求(每种类型,只需替换“blabla”)。
所以我有一个使用sailsjs的nodejs应用程序网络框架。在开发过程中,我将适配器设置为sails-disk。disk.db中的示例数据类似于{"data":{"authentication":[{"user_id":1,"username":"user1","encrypted_password":"passwordhere","createdAt":"2014-05-12T07:40:24.901Z","updatedAt":"2014-08-18T19:37:22.851Z","id":1,"email":"user1@email.com"}],"user":[{"name"
我使用nodejs服务器并使用mongoose在本地连接到MongoDB:mongooseQ.connect("mongodb://localhost:27017/YepiMobile");如何从我的机器连接到位于远程服务器上的mongo数据库?类似于:mongooseQ.connect("mongodb://remote.server.com:27017/YepiMobile"); 最佳答案 第二次连接尝试是否失败,通过阅读Mongoose的文档似乎您已经正确完成了:mongoose.connect('mongodb://user
在我们添加数据库之前,我们的Passport登录工作正常。现在我们似乎正在保存一个不是facebookID的ID它正在保存_ID,我们无法从我们的数据库中检索facebook数据。所以我猜问题是它没有正确保存到数据库,但不确定为什么。passport.serializeUser(function(user,done){console.log('serializeUser:'+user.id)done(null,user.id);});passport.deserializeUser(function(id,done){console.log(id)User.findById(id,fu
当我使用FindOne时,它说“'MongoClientExtensions.GetServer(MongoClient)'isobsolete:'UsethenewAPIinstead.'Observer.Client”作为警告。这是我的代码collection.EnsureIndex(IndexKeys.Ascending("Username","Type"),IndexOptions.SetUnique(true));varuserlog=collection.FindOne(Query.Where(ul=>ul.Username==username&&ul.Type==ty
我在www.myweb.io中有一个数据库,它有SSL。服务端mongo版本为2.6.12:本地mongo版本为3.4.1。我想把它转储到我的本地机器上,修改它,然后恢复回来。我试过了mongodump--hostwww.myweb.io--port22--usernamemyname--password"mypassword"它给了我一个错误:2017-11-20T20:57:07.775+0100Failed:errorconnectingtodbserver:noreachableservers有人知道我应该设置什么主机和帖子吗?PS:在我的本地主机上,我可以使用Robo3T中的